What is YMCA OF GREATER PGH/HOMEWOOD-BRUSHTON YMCA's Keystone STARS rating?
- Pennsylvania rates YMCA OF GREATER PGH/HOMEWOOD-BRUSHTON YMCA STAR 1, on a scale of one to four where four is highest. That tier took effect on August 26, 2024. Keystone STARS measures programme standards such as staff qualifications and learning environment, not inspection outcomes.

Does this page show inspection results for YMCA OF GREATER PGH/HOMEWOOD-BRUSHTON YMCA?
- No. Pennsylvania completes at least one unannounced inspection a year at every licensed provider, and publishes the results through the provider search at compass.dhs.pa.gov/providersearch. Those results are not included here, and there is no open dataset of them, so nothing on this page reflects YMCA OF GREATER PGH/HOMEWOOD-BRUSHTON YMCA's inspection history either way.
